陈娜 阮晟懿 薛珂磊 诸梦瑶 何毅辛 刘亚林 赵哲韬 尉鹏飞
摘 要:本文简要介绍了目前雨伞寄存时存在的易丢失、错拿等问题,结合电磁学、无线技术、电路原理、自动控制原理等方面知识,在普通伞架的基础上设计制作了一种可以记录个人信息与通过电子控制开锁的多选择解锁的雨伞存放装置,并对其原理与多选择解锁带来的便捷使用方式进行了详细的阐述,最后我们对此装置在共享模式和便民服务方面的应用与推广进行了展望。
关键词:雨伞存放 多选择解锁 共享模式 便民服务
中图分类号:TU855 文献标识码:A 文章编号:1674-098X(2019)04(a)-0151-03
1 研究背景
雨天出行时,雨伞作为一种不可或缺的携带品,其随意放置导致的丢伞现象成为一个值得引起重视的问题。通过校内问卷调查(70.99%调研对象为大一、大二学生),我们发现大学在校期间,58.2%的学生存在丢失过雨伞的情况,其中,雨伞丢失数量达到三把及三把以上的占总调查人数16%,这表明大学生丢伞问题或者丢伞问题,是一种普遍现象。调查还发现,53.69%的学生在教室丢失过雨伞,39.6%的学生在图书馆、商场丢失过雨伞,错拿、忘拿雨伞是雨伞丢失的主要原因。因此,教室、图书馆、商场等公共场所都急需一种便捷安全的雨伞放置装置。此外,调查显示,95.31%的大学生认为,刷卡开锁方式放置雨伞优于钥匙开锁方式。而我们设计的多选择解锁的雨傘放置器利用不同类型磁卡进行刷卡开锁和精准的数据记录,在刷卡放伞时自动开启雨伞锁环,防止雨伞错拿现象。若此装置效果良好,在后续的开发中,即可进一步建设提供刷卡借伞服务的平台,以建立一种安全有效的“共享雨伞”新模式,成为一项有利的便民新举措。
2 系统结构单元
伞架示意图如图1所示,其中1是磁卡刷卡器;2是单片机;3是数据储存模块;4是稳压模块;5是蜂鸣器;6、7、8、9、10、11是电控锁;12是整个装置的外金属框架;13是锁环;14、15是万向轮;16是电源线;17是信号线;18、19、20、21、22、23是指示灯。
2.1 磁卡模块
磁卡刷卡器1用于接收磁卡信号,将持卡人磁卡信息储存于数据储存模块3,并将该信号传输至单片机模块2。
2.2 单片机模块
单片机2用于分析处理磁卡信号,并根据情况打开电控锁6、7、8、9、10、11中指定电控锁,控制蜂鸣器5发出一段短提示音。
2.3 电控锁组
电控锁6、7、8、9、10、11用于在单片机2的控制下开启,使用户能够存取雨伞。
2.4 指示灯组
指示灯18、19、20、21、22、23用于在单片机2的控制下通过闪烁提示用户电控锁已打开。
2.5 蜂鸣器
蜂鸣器5用于在单片机2的控制下通过鸣叫提示用户电控锁已打开。
2.6 供电模块
稳压模块4和电源线16配合工作,组成供电模块,用于给控制模块供电,以确保控制模块正常工作。
2.7 外壳及底座
整个装置的外金属框架12作为支架,万向轮14、15方便装置移动。
3 工作原理及逻辑流程
3.1 工作原理
(1)电源开启,系统参数初始化。
(2)判断磁卡刷卡器是否检测到磁卡信息同时判断是否有按键输入,若检测到磁卡,则读取持卡人磁卡信息并进入流程a,若检测到有按键输入,则进入到流程c。
①流程a。
1)判断磁卡信息对应电控锁编号是否为第一个电控锁编号,若是,直接进行步骤3),若否,则进行步骤2);
2)判断磁卡信息对应电控锁编号是否为下一个电控锁编号,若是,进行步骤3),若否,则继续重复步骤2),若无下一电控锁,进入流程b;
3)打开此编号对应电控锁并把当前电磁锁次数清零,蜂鸣器发出一段短提示音、指示灯闪烁一次,结束流程。
②流程b。
1)检测第一个电控锁打开次数是否为1,若是,进行步骤Ⅱ,若否,则直接进行步骤3);
2)检测下一个电控锁打开次数是否为0,若是,进行步骤3),若否,则继续重复步骤2),若后续无可检测的电控锁,则发出一段长提示音,回到流程2;
3)打开此时检测的电控锁,蜂鸣器发出一段短提示音、指示灯闪烁一次;
4)将此张磁卡信息写入到单片机中与此电控锁相对应的位置,回到流程2。
③流程c。
1)检测下一按键输入,直到输满,等待用户确认,确认完毕后进行步骤2);
2)检测当前输入密码是否正确,若是则进入步骤3),若否则回到流程2;
3)打开此时检测的电控锁,蜂鸣器发出一段短提示音、指示灯闪烁一次;
4)若输入需要打开的电控锁编号,则打开相应的电控锁,若输入退出,则回到流程2。
3.2 逻辑流程
本装置的逻辑流程图如图2所示。
3.3 理想化模型的说明
伞架的电控锁锁只设置了自动打开,无自动关锁功能,需要用户自行关闭。根据实际情况,放伞时用户必定会将锁关闭(否则雨伞无法放在伞架上);取伞后,根据用户在生活中使用商场寄存柜的经验,用户一般会习惯性将锁扣关闭,若用户不慎忘记,后来的用户也一般不会将伞直接放入。若真有不慎将雨伞放入未关闭的锁中的情况出现,我们也有设置管理员解锁模块,用户可联系管理员取伞。
4 模块参数及选择考量
系统主要由单片机模块、稳压模块、显示模块、射频模块4部分组成。
4.1 单片机模块
本装置使用STC89C52RC单片机,其是宏晶科技推出的新一代高速/低功耗/超强抗干扰的单片机,指令代码完全兼容传统 8051 单片机,12时钟/机器周期和6时钟/机器周期可以任意选择。
主要特性如下:
(1)增强型8051单片机,6时钟/机器周期和12时钟/机器周期可以任意选择,指令代码完全兼容传统8051。
(2)工作电压:5.5~3.3V(5V单片机)/3.8~2.0V(3V单片机)。
(3)工作频率范围:0~40MHz,相当于普通8051的 0~80MHz,实际工作频率可达48MHz 。
(4)用户应用程序空间为 8K 字节。
(5)片上集成 512 字节 RAM。
(6)通用I/O口(32个)复位后为:P1/P2/P3/P4是准双向口/弱上拉,P0口是漏极开路输出,作为总线扩展用时,不用加上拉电阻,作为I/O口用时,需加上拉电阻。
(7)ISP(在系统可编程)/IAP(在应用可编程),无需专用编程器,无需专用仿真器,可通过串口(RxD/P3.0,TxD/P3.1)直接下载用户程序,数秒即可完成一片。
(8)具有EEPROM功能。
(9)具有看门狗功能。
(10)共3个16位定时器/计数器,即定时器T0、T1、T2。
(11)外部中断4路,下降沿中断或低电平触发电路,Power Down 模式可由外部中断低电平触发中断方式唤醒。
(12)通用异步串行口(UART),还可用定时器软件实现多个UART。
(13)工作温度范围:-40~+85℃(工业级)/0~75℃(商业级)。
(14)PDIP 封装。
4.2 稳压模块
本装置使用LM1117线性稳压集成电路,LM1117是三端可调输出的线性稳压器集成电路。LM1117的输出电压范围是1.2~37V,负载电流最大为1.5A。
在本装置中选用的是3.3V的规格,不需要调节电压,所以不需要加电阻,但为了保证输出电压稳定,加入了输出电容和输入电容。
4.3 显示模块
在本装置中使用的是LED显示屏,1602LCD主要技术参数为:显示容量为16×2个字符,工作电流为2.0mA(5.0V),模块最佳工作电压为5.0V,字符尺寸2.95mm×4.35mm(W×H)。
4.4 射频模块
在本装置中使用的是RFID-RC522射频模块,MF RC522 是应用于13.56MHz非接触式通信中高集成度读写卡系列芯片中的一员。是NXP公司针对“三表”应用推出的一款低 电压、低成本、体积小的非接触式读写卡芯片,是智能仪表和便携 式手持设备研发的较好选择 。
MF RC522利用了先进的调制和解调概念,完全集成了在13.56MHz下所有类型的被动非接触式通信方式和协议。支持ISO14443A的多层应用。其内部发送器部分可驱动读写器天线与ISO 14443A/MIFARE卡和应答机的通信,无需其它的电路。接收器部分提供一个坚固而有效的解调和解码电路,用于处理ISO14443A兼容的应答器信号。数字部分处理ISO14443A帧和错误检测(奇偶 &CRC)。此外,它还支持快速CRYPTO1加密算法,用于驗证MIFARE系列产品。MFRC522支持MIFARE?更高速的非接触式通信,双向数据传输速率高达424kbit/s。
作为13.56MHz高集成度读写卡系列芯片家族的新成员,MF RC522与MF RC500和MF RC530有不少相似之处,同时也具备诸多特点和差异。它与主机间的通信采用连线较少的串行通信,且可根据不同的用户需求,选取SPI、I2C 或串行UART(类似RS232)模式之一,有利于减少连线,缩小PCB 板体积,降低成本。
5 结语
随着社会经济的快速发展和人民生活水平的不断提高,国家大力提升发展质量和效益,更好地满足人民日益增长的美好生活需要。本组提出的模型以人流量大的场所为背景,使用磁卡识别技术以达到利用不同种类磁卡进行多选择解锁,极大地提高了雨伞存取效率并增强了雨伞存取安全性,实现了更为便捷的人机交互,且该装置具有多选择的解锁功能,能够有效识别校园卡、图书卡、银行卡等磁卡,适用广大人群与多种场合。若此装置效果良好,在后续的开发中:第一,可以在不同场地进行放置,有效防止雨伞丢失,解决生活中极其普遍却让人困扰的丢伞问题,以此作为一项便民措施;第二,可进一步建设提供刷卡借伞服务的平台,以建立一种安全有效的“共享雨伞”新模式;第三,可为其他寄存服务带来多选择解锁的新思路。
参考文献
[1] 孤灯下亮.共享雨伞离不开信用做伞架[J].人民法治,2017(7):66.
[2] 王红林.基于RFID技术的门控管理系统设计与实现[D].南京信息工程大学,2006.
[3] 秦阳,高欣怡,王宇娣,等.基于校园卡的智能诚信伞架——建设诚信校园[J].科技经济市场,2017(3):135-136.
[4] 刘升涛.基于RFID的智能工具管理系统的设计与实现[D].西南交通大学,2017.
[5] 郁美霞. 基于校园卡的智能储物柜人机交互系统的设计[D].兰州交通大学,2015.
[6] 陈晓萌.报警防丢 预报天气 智能雨伞来了![N].消费日报,2016-05-27.